Understanding Storage Options for the Galaxy Note 20
The Galaxy Note 20 comes with different storage capacities, which significantly influence its resale value. Typically, these models are available in:
- 128GB
- 256GB
- 512GB (available in some variants)
When selling, it’s important to specify the exact storage size of your device. Higher storage models tend to fetch higher prices because they offer more space for apps, photos, and documents.
Factors Affecting the Price of Your Galaxy Note 20
Several factors influence the resale value of your Galaxy Note 20:
- Storage capacity: Larger storage sizes typically command higher prices.
- Condition of the device: Devices in excellent condition with minimal scratches or damages sell for more.
- Age of the device: Newer models are more desirable and priced higher.
- Market demand: Prices fluctuate based on current demand for the Galaxy Note 20.
Current Market Prices for the Galaxy Note 20
Prices vary depending on the storage size and condition. As of recent market trends, approximate prices are:
- 128GB model: $200 – $350
- 256GB model: $250 – $400
- 512GB model: $300 – $450
These prices are estimates and can vary based on your location and the platform you choose to sell on, such as eBay, Swappa, or local marketplaces.
Tips for Selling Your Galaxy Note 20
Maximize your selling price by following these tips:
- Clean the device: Remove fingerprints and dirt for a better presentation.
- Reset to factory settings: Erase all personal data for privacy and a fresh start.
- Provide original accessories: Including the charger and box can increase appeal.
- Take high-quality photos: Clear images help attract buyers.
- Research current prices: Check similar listings to set a competitive price.
